EDITORS COMMENTS
This evocative print, titled "The Royal Dockyard at Deptford, circa 1810," offers a captivating glimpse into the past of Britain's maritime history. The image, published around the turn of the 19th century, depicts the bustling Deptford Docks, located in the heart of London's historic Royal Borough. At the center of the composition, the grand Royal Dockyard stands proudly, its imposing walls and towering chimneys dominating the landscape. Established by King Henry VIII in 1513, the dockyard was a vital hub for the British Navy, responsible for building, repairing, and maintaining warships. The yard's significance is underscored by the presence of several impressive vessels moored alongside the docks, their sails furled and masts towering high above the waterline. The surrounding area teems with activity, with workers and sailors going about their daily tasks. Men can be seen loading and unloading cargo from the ships, while others are engaged in various repairs and maintenance activities. The hustle and bustle of the dockyard is mirrored in the busy waterfront, where smaller boats and barges ferry goods to and from the larger ships. The print also reveals the rich architectural heritage of the area, with a variety of buildings and structures dotting the landscape. The elegant Deptford Bridge, designed by Christopher Wren, can be seen in the background, spanning the River Thames and connecting Deptford to the rest of London. This image, with its intricate details and atmospheric depiction of a bygone era, offers a fascinating window into the past, transporting us back to a time when Deptford Docks were at the heart of Britain's maritime empire.
